Thirteen of my twenty-one kindergarten students speak another language at home but they develop language fluency every day as they participate in learning at school. Our school has over 80% of our children receiving free and reduced lunches. My students love learning. They get so excited when they hear a fun story and I delight in the understanding they gain from listening to stories and discussing them with friends. The students come to kindergarten eager to learn and I would appreciate having a few more tools to help them become successful readers.
